if f(x) varies directly with x and f(x) = 50 when x = -10, then what is f(x) when x = 15

Respuesta :

mssarkar96 mssarkar96
  • 02-04-2016
f(x)=50 x= -10

If x=1, then f(x)=50/-10 = -5

Therefor, when x=15, f(x) = 15*-5 = -30
